Transaction efcf42f91fe189262c9513d5a46cefdf847c3b42d07c4e142bfaa1ec6242b7d8
1 Input
1 Output
-
efcf42f91fe189262c9513d5a46cefdf847c3b42d07c4e142bfaa1ec6242b7d8:0
- value
- 4821489
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d25cfe4d5f659a4a36f84aea34920520e73e172f OP_EQUAL
- address
- 3LsKE7x4W5QhXfvf1PT964pF7e4vEN4zjj